PETALING JAYA, 10 February 2025 – Thomson Fertility (also known as TMC Fertility and  Women’s Specialist Centre) proudly announces the launch of Endo Care @ Thomson, a  holistic care centre dedicated to addressing endometriosis-related issues among women. This  initiative was officially kickstarted at the Holistic Endometriosis Care Awareness Talk and  Workshop, at the Endo Care Centre, Thomson Hospital Kota Damansara.  

In collaboration with MyEndosis (Endometriosis Association of Malaysia), the workshop  featured a series of expert-led discussions, interactive sessions, and practical demonstrations  designed to empower women with crucial knowledge about endometriosis.

The centre aims to provide a multidisciplinary and patient-centric approach to diagnosis and  treatment by offering: 

  • Advanced diagnostics for accurate detection 
  • Comprehensive treatment options, including medical, surgical, and fertility-related  interventions 
  • Multidisciplinary expertise, collaborating with urologists, colorectal surgeons, and  cardiothoracic surgeons 
  • Pelvic pain management, featuring personalised pelvic physiotherapy plans 

Oxford-trained Prof. Dr. Prasanna Supramaniam highlighted the importance of this initiative:  “Endometriosis is a complex condition that requires a holistic and tailored approach. The  centre is designed to ensure women receive the right diagnosis and care plan, improving their  overall well-being and fertility outcomes.” 

Dr Prasanna Supramaniam shares on effective endometriosis management

Endo Care @ Thomson is modelled after the Oxford Endometriosis Centre and aspires to  become a referral centre for endometriosis, pioneering a holistic entire pathway for  endometriosis management. To further its commitment, Endo Care @ Thomson will host Endometriosis Day once a month, on the first Saturday of each month, featuring talks,  workshops, and free endometriosis consultations

Multi-disciplinary and Comprehensive Approach to Care 

Endo Care @ Thomson takes a multidisciplinary approach to endometriosis care, bringing  together expert specialists to provide comprehensive diagnosis, personalised treatment, and  management.  

Datuk Dr Mohd Hamzah Kamarulzaman explained this in depth, saying, “Endometriosis isn’t  just a reproductive disorder; it can invade the lungs and diaphragm, causing sudden lung  collapse, internal bleeding, and severe breathing difficulties. This often-misdiagnosed  condition, known as Thoracic Endometriosis Syndrome (TES), can be debilitating. When  medication fails, life-changing intervention is possible through minimally invasive video  assisted thoracoscopic surgery performed by a cardiothoracic surgeon. Combined with post 

operative hormonal therapy, this approach offers the best chance at preventing recurrence  and restoring quality of life. Awareness is critical, early diagnosis and the right treatment can  be the difference between suffering in silence and reclaiming one’s health.”
